Clear juice contains roughly 85% water. To conserve energy, sugar factories utilize multiple-effect evaporators. Rein’s textbook provides extensive design equations for calculating heat transfer coefficients, vapor bleeding schemes, and steam economies. Efficient heat integration allows a well-designed factory to run entirely on the energy generated by burning its own byproduct, bagasse. 5. His book, Cane Sugar Engineering , first published as a successor to E. Hugot’s classic Handbook of Cane Sugar Engineering , updated the discipline for the modern era. Rein introduced contemporary mathematical modeling, automated control systems, and strict energy-conservation principles that define modern, high-efficiency sugar mills. Peter Rein’s Cane Sugar Engineering remains a foundational cornerstone of sugar processing literature. By seamlessly blending rigorous chemical engineering theory with practical, on-the-ground factory mechanics, Rein created a timeless roadmap for processing sugarcane efficiently. As the industry transitions toward high-tech automation and expanded biorefining, the core thermodynamic and mechanical principles established in his work continue to guide the next generation of sugar engineers worldwide.
